DNCC to give ‘Citizen Award’ for contribution to city development 

BSS
Published On: 17 Jul 2025, 19:45 Updated On:17 Jul 2025, 19:48

DHAKA, July 17, 2025 (BSS)- Dhaka North City Corporation (DNCC) has taken initiative to give ‘Citizen Award-2025’ to individuals and organizations for their contribution to city’s development.

“The award, first of its kind, will be given for contribution to city development, environment conservation, social service and services for raising public awareness on impending issues,” DNCC administrator Mohammad Ezaz said.

The motto of the award is to create a responsible society of the citizens with the theme ‘My city, My Responsibility’.

The DNCC administrator said, it’s possible to build a sustainable city for future through recognizing and encouraging the initiatives of the citizens, their environment friendly thinking and services to the society.

This initiative would help the young generation to connect with social leaders and innovative practices, he added.

The individuals and organizations who are the driver of positive changes in the areas of education, technology and culture are the real claimer of the award.

The citizen award will be given 30 persons or organizations under six categories. Any person, social organization, small entrepreneurs, medial or content creator and innovator or start-up who are playing a positive role in city’s development will be nominated for the award.

Online application form for the award will be available on the DNCC official website from current month. However, active politicians and persons convicted on corrupt charges cannot apply.

Interested persons, institutions or organizations can apply along with the description of the project, picture and videos and necessary documents.
